Default F100s

I recently bought 2 of the F100 classics and spec`ed them with lead tape to bring up the weight, swingweight and balance...something which I have done with my Aerogel 100s and 4Ds too. The new offering from Dunlop is sweet...the frame material seems a little softer, but they play almost the same as my 4Ds. They are by far better than the previous biomimetic 100, which I bought, spec`ed and eventually got rid of as they didn't play to my liking. TW Europe and many European sites have them...unfortunately they won't be released in the US or Asia at all, so your only option is to buy them online. Definitely worth the wait...I really recommend them.
